You likely have a layer of dead grass, leaves, pine needles, and other debris over the top of your soil. This layer chokes the grass, limits its access to sunshine, and doesn\u2019t allow the proper airflow to get things growing. This elimination process is known as dethatching.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Dethatching requires a lot of elbow grease to remove this impenetrable layer. You\u2019ll need to give it a thorough rake to remove all of these things crowding your grass.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Aerate Your Soil<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Whether your yard sees lots of foot traffic or not, the soil is likely to have become quite hard over the months and years since you last tended it. Soil that has been packed down makes it difficult to get water and nutrients into the dirt to nourish your new grass. To remedy this, you will need to rent an <a href=\"https:\/\/gocleanr.com\/winnipeg\/lawn-care\/aeration\/\">aerator<\/a> (or hire a lawn care company like Cleanr Property Maintenance).<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Kill the Weeds<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p><a href=\"\/winnipeg\/lawn-care\/weed-control-fertilizer\/\">Eliminating weeds<\/a> is crucial before you start to plant new grass seed. Weeds will steal nutrients, light, and water from your new grass, so rip them out at the roots. You can do this manually if they are easy to grasp and pull. However, you can also spray them with herbicides to get similar results.\u00a0<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>It might take some time to clear your yard of these unwanted guests, but the investment will be well worth it.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Overseed Your Yard<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Once your soil is ready for new grass seed, it is time to overseed the yard. Select a grass seed that matches the species you would naturally find in your area. Then, rake the soil to get it primed to accept the seed. Lightly rake the grass seed into the soil upon completion, making sure to spread it as evenly as possible.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Don\u2019t forget that it\u2019s crucial to water your new grass seed often to help lush, green grass sprout!<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Leave It to the Professionals<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Not sure how to best approach a neglected or damaged lawn to bring it back to its former glory?
